| book description |
This book focuses on recent advances in the field of social robots and their integration in education. It elaborates on the progressive evolution of human-robot interaction and educational robotics, the emergence of digital pedagogy, and the implementation of personalized learning methodologies. The book also examines the use of artificial intelligence (AI) in education through the lenses of social robots. Hence, the book offers an overview of recent research into the adoption, integration, advancements, and impact of social robots and AI in education and presents guidelines and suggestions on how to integrate them in classrooms. Specifically, the book: Provides an in-depth overview of social robots and their use in education. Presents the advances of social robots and AI in education. Showcases innovative solutions and outcomes of integrating social robots in classrooms. Discusses the challenges, benefits, and future research directions of using social robots and AI in education.
